WebDec 30, 2016 · Step 1 The pressure point P-6, or Neiguan, is located three fingers’ widths below your wrist crease. To find it, flatten your palm and place the first three fingers of your opposite hand across your wrist. Step 2 Place your thumb on the point below your index fingers between two large tendons. WebUse your thumb or index finger to massage the pressure points. You can also use more than one finger or the heel of your hand to press on these points. Use firm but gentle pressure. Use a circular motion when applying pressure to these points. Press for at least two to three minutes on each point. Repeat a few times a day. how much are closing costs in illinois
